If you’ve ever opened a hive and struggled to pull frames apart because of a sticky, brown substance, you’ve already met propolis. But what is propolis, exactly and why do bees rely on it so heavily?
Often called “bee glue,” propolis is a resinous material that honey bees create by mixing plant resins with beeswax and enzymes. The name comes from Greek origins meaning “in front of the city,” which is fitting. Inside the hive, this substance acts as both shield and sealant, protecting the colony like defensive walls around a fortress.

How Bees Make Propolis

Worker bees collect sticky resins from tree buds, sap flows, and plant wounds. You’ll often see them gathering material from poplars, conifers, or eucalyptus, depending on the region. They store the resin in their pollen baskets and carry it back to the hive.
Once inside, other bees help remove the resin. It is chewed, mixed with wax and enzymes, and transformed into the final compound. The result is a flexible, glue-like material that hardens over time.
Because bees collect resin from local plants, the exact composition varies from hive to hive. Even so, propolis typically contains flavonoids, phenolic acids, essential oils, and natural waxes compounds known for their protective properties.

What Do Bees Use Propolis For?

Inside the hive, this resin plays several critical roles.
First, bees use it as a structural sealant. It fills cracks, smooths rough surfaces, strengthens comb edges, and waterproofs internal walls. Bees may even narrow the hive entrance with it, making it harder for predators to enter.
More importantly, it acts as part of the colony’s immune defence.
Research shows that propolis has strong antimicrobial activity. It helps suppress bacteria, fungi, and other pathogens that could threaten the colony. When disease pressure increases, bees often gather more resin to reinforce the hive interior.
In some cases, if a small intruder dies inside the hive and cannot be removed, bees coat it in propolis to prevent decomposition. This limits contamination and protects the rest of the colony.
For bees, it’s both building material and medicine.

Propolis Benefits for Humans

Humans have used propolis for thousands of years, long before laboratories studied its properties. Ancient civilisations valued it for wound care and preservation. Today, modern research continues to explore its potential.
Some of the most recognised propolis benefits include:

Antimicrobial Support

Laboratory studies show it may help inhibit certain bacteria, viruses, and fungi. This explains why it is commonly found in throat sprays, lozenges, and tinctures.

Anti-Inflammatory Properties

Compounds within propolis appear to reduce inflammatory responses. Because of this, it is often included in creams for irritated or sensitive skin.

Antioxidant Activity

Rich in flavonoids, it helps neutralise oxidative stress in the body. Antioxidants play an important role in overall cellular health.

Skin and Wound Care

Propolis is frequently used in ointments designed to support minor wound healing, burns, acne recovery, and other skin concerns.

Oral Health

Its antibacterial action makes it a popular ingredient in toothpaste and mouthwash products aimed at reducing plaque and supporting gum health.
While research is ongoing, interest in this hive product continues to grow due to its broad biological activity.

Is Propolis Safe to Use?

For most people, propolis is considered safe. However, individuals with bee-related allergies should exercise caution. As with any natural product, it’s wise to perform a patch test before applying it to the skin.
If irritation or sensitivity occurs, discontinue use and consult a healthcare professional.

Ethical and Sustainable Harvesting

Because propolis plays a vital role in hive health, responsible harvesting matters. Ethical beekeepers collect only excess buildup often from frame edges and avoid removing large quantities before winter. The colony depends on it for insulation and disease resistance.
Supporting local, sustainability-focused beekeepers ensures that this valuable hive product is sourced without compromising bee wellbeing.
